,Integer>(); //循环字符串中的字符 for(int i=0;i<sourc ...
如果明天你要参加一场面试,面试官有个题目是:说说String StringBuffer StringBuilder它们之间的区别 你会怎么回答呢 脑补一下答案 今天,小编就来和大家详细聊聊字符串String StringBuffer StringBuilder,告诉你怎样完美的回答以上面试官的问题,希望对你有帮助。 考点分析 这个题目也是考查字符串相关的。对于这个题目,我们通过阅读源码来验证我们 ...
2018-02-13 09:20 0 1223 推荐指数:
,Integer>(); //循环字符串中的字符 for(int i=0;i<sourc ...
难度:容易 字符串查找(又称查找子字符串),是字符串操作中一个很有用的函数。你的任务是实现这个函数。 对于一个给定的 source 字符串和一个 target 字符串,你应该在 source 字符串中找出 target 字符串出现的第一个位置(从0开始)。 如果不存在,则返回 ...
一、计算字符在给定字符串中出现的次数 二、计算字符串在给定字符串中出现的次数 ...
目录: 1. 编程题目 2. 方法一 3. 方法二 4. 方法三 5. 方法四 6. 总结 正文: 1. 编程题目 写一个方法,输入一个文件名和一个字符串,统计这个字符串在这个文件中出现的次数。 2. 方法一 废话少说,先来看看方法一的代码 ...
这道题是字节的面试题,当场问我有点紧张没想出来,只答上来要交替阻塞,还是面试官提醒我用生产者消费者思路解决。 题目 有A类线程50个,任务是打印字符A。有B类线程50个,任务是打印字符B。现在异步启动这100个线程,问如何才能让他们交替打印AB字符? 解题思路 设两个信号 ...
用递归实现字符串反转 题目描述:对一个字符串,如何用递归方式实现字符串的反转。如字符串:“123456”,用递归实现反转后,效果是“654321”。 思路:将字符串转换成字符数组,每次截取字符串的首字符放到最后,并再次对剩余字符串递归截取首字符,直到满足if条件( 递归实现字符串 ...
前言:周末闲来无事,看了看字符串相关算法的讲解视频,收货颇丰,跟着视频讲解简单做了一下笔记,方便以后翻阅复习同时也很乐意分享给大家。什么字符串在算法中有多重要之类的大路边上的客套话就不多说了,直接上笔记吧。 一、字符串 java:String内置类型,不可更改。(如需更改可考 ...
题目描述 输入一个字符串,按字典序打印出该字符串中字符的所有排列。例如输入字符串abc,则打印出由字符a,b,c所能排列出来的所有字符串abc,acb,bac,bca,cab和cba。 输入描述: 输入一个字符串,长度不超过9(可能有字符重复),字符只包括大小写字母。 这里尤其 ...